Cylinder player. Manufactured by the Columbia Phonograph Co. Serial # 288464. Last patent date on manufacturer plate: Mar 30, 1897. Crank missing and as such, this piece is untested. Metal base mount exhibits oxidation. Finishes on base unit and lid are noticeably different so this is likely a marriage of parts. Finishes appear original as do the decals on the case (which are exhibiting quite a bit of deterioration). Oak finish on the base appears fine by and large while on the lid (hueing closer to mahogany) cracking, warping and peeling is evident. An approximately 1/4" wide piece of wood has splintered off from the rear of the base. Base unit measures approximately 13" wide, 12" high and 8" deep (13" high with lid attached). Sold as-is.
